Dubai RTA License Conversion: What You Need to Know
The Emirates ID Rule That Catches People Off Guard
Dubai RTA will only process your license conversion if your Emirates ID is Dubai-issued. This is the single most common rejection reason we see. Residents who live in Sharjah, Ajman, or Umm Al Quwain but work in Dubai cannot convert at Dubai RTA.
Check the issuing emirate on your Emirates ID before visiting RTA. If it shows any emirate other than Dubai, you must convert through that emirate’s traffic authority instead. We verify this when you send us your documents.
Approved Countries for Direct Conversion at Dubai RTA
Dubai RTA allows direct license conversion for holders from these countries:
GCC Countries: Saudi Arabia, Kuwait, Bahrain, Oman, Qatar
Europe: United Kingdom, Germany, France, Italy, Spain, Netherlands, Belgium, Austria, Switzerland, Sweden, Norway, Denmark, Finland, Ireland, Portugal, Greece, Poland, Turkey
Americas: United States, Canada
Asia Pacific: Japan, South Korea, Singapore, Hong Kong, Australia, New Zealand
Other: South Africa
This list is updated periodically by the UAE government. If your country is not listed, send us your license and we confirm your status.
Countries Requiring the Driving Test in Dubai
If your country is not on the approved list, you need driving lessons and the RTA test. Common nationalities requiring testing include:
- India, Pakistan, Bangladesh, Sri Lanka
- Philippines, Indonesia, Thailand, Vietnam
- Egypt, Jordan, Lebanon, Syria
- Nigeria, Kenya, Ethiopia
- China (Mainland)
- Most South American countries
Experienced drivers sometimes qualify for reduced lesson packages. Your translated license helps demonstrate your driving background to the school.
Dubai RTA Centers by Area
Dubai has three main RTA service centers that process license conversions. Each center has nearby typing centers and opticians for a streamlined experience.
Deira RTA Center (Al Ittihad Road) — The largest RTA service center in Dubai. Located on Al Ittihad Road near Deira City Centre. This center handles the highest volume of license conversions and has the most typing centers nearby. Convenient for residents of Deira, Bur Dubai, and Creek-area neighbourhoods.
Al Barsha RTA Center — Located near Mall of the Emirates in Al Barsha. This center serves residents of Dubai Marina, JLT, Barsha, and the surrounding areas. Typing centers and opticians are located within walking distance. Generally less crowded than Deira.
Umm Ramool RTA Center — Situated near Dubai International Airport. This center is convenient for residents of Ras Al Khor, Mirdif, and communities near the airport. It offers the same license conversion services as the other centers but with shorter wait times during off-peak hours.
RTA Smart App Process
Dubai RTA offers some license services through the RTA Smart App. You can check your application status, pay fees, and schedule appointments through the app. However, the initial file opening for license conversion still requires an in-person visit to an RTA center.
After your file is opened, the app allows you to:
- Track your application progress
- Pay outstanding fees
- Book driving test appointments (for non-approved countries)
- Receive notifications when your license is ready
Download the RTA Dubai app from Google Play or Apple App Store before your first visit. Creating an account takes a few minutes.
Common Rejection Reasons at Dubai RTA
- Emirates ID from wrong emirate: Your ID must show Dubai as the issuing emirate. Sharjah, Ajman, or any other emirate means you cannot use Dubai RTA.
- Expired eye test certificate: The eye test must be current at the time of submission. Get the eye test on the same day or the day before your RTA visit.
- Name mismatch: Your name on the translated license must match your passport exactly. Spelling variations between documents cause processing delays.
- Missing license categories: If your license includes motorcycle or heavy vehicle categories, these must appear in the translation. Our translators include every category visible on the original.
- Non-MOJ translation: Dubai RTA only accepts translations from MOJ-licensed translators. Translations from non-licensed providers or other countries are rejected. Read about a real case where an Urdu license was rejected by RTA and how it was resolved.
- Tourist visa: License conversion requires a valid UAE residence visa. Visitors on tourist visas cannot convert their foreign license.

License Categories That Can Be Converted
Your translation includes every category on your original license:
- Category 1/A (Motorcycle): Convertible from approved countries. Engine size restrictions carry over.
- Category 2/B (Light Vehicle): The most common conversion. Automatic-only restriction carries over if present.
- Category 3/C (Heavy Vehicle): Additional employer documentation may be required.
- Category 4/D (Bus): Requires employment proof with a passenger transport company.
- Automatic vs Manual: Manual license holders get unrestricted UAE licenses. Automatic-only holders receive the automatic restriction.
Expired Licenses at Dubai RTA
You can translate an expired license, but RTA has time limits on acceptance:
- Expired less than 6 months: Usually accepted without question
- Expired 6 months to 2 years: May be accepted with proof of renewal in progress
- Expired more than 2 years: Typically requires fresh license from home country
If your license is close to expiry, consider converting before it lapses. This avoids additional paperwork.
International Driving Permit vs MOJ Translation
An International Driving Permit (IDP) is not a substitute for MOJ-certified translation at Dubai RTA. The RTA requires translation of your actual national license, not the IDP. However, an IDP is useful while waiting for your UAE license to be processed.
